In our top story. After a good start at the box office, Sara Ali Khan and Vicky Kaushal‘s romantic comedy Zara Hatke Zara Bachke has witnessed a slight drop. The film, which opened to mixed reviews from critics, earned around Rs 4.41 crore, taking its total earnings to Rs 26.73 crore. The film, which is said to have profited from its unique ticket-selling strategy of one plus one free, valid until Sunday, 4th June, has performed decently at the box office without any sales aid. Directed by Laxman Utekar, Zara Hatke Zara Bachke, set in a small town in India, revolves around a married couple trying to get a fake divorce. The film marks Vicky and Sara’s first film together.

 

Moving on. Bollywood star Swara Bhasker on Tuesday, 6th June, announced that she is expecting her first child. Sharing a few photos with her husband, Fahad Ahmad, the actor flaunted her baby bump as she made the big announcement. Taking to Instagram to inform her followers that the baby is due in October, she wrote – “Sometimes all your prayers are answered all together! Blessed, grateful, excited (and clueless!) as we step into a whole new world!” Swara’s followers dropped messages congratulating the couple in the post’s comments section. Swara Bhasker and Fahad Ahmad registered their marriage in February, this year. They later hosted a grand celebration to commemorate their union.

 

Journalist-author Shubhra Gupta’s upcoming book ‘Irrfan: Life in Movies’, published by Pan Macmillan India, traces the late star’s journey and features many of his collaborators including Tigmanshu Dhulia. In an exclusive excerpt from the upcoming book, Dhulia shared – “I think if I consider Irrfan – not anyone else’s contribution so much – I would say his best performance is Paan Singh Tomar, undoubtedly. Irrfan’s method when he was working was also how he lived his life. He was a good actor because his observation of life was very surgical, very meticulous. Irrfan’s observation of life was so nice that his performance always used to look fresh, and unpredictable. He used to rise above his character.”

 

Meanwhile, more than 15 years later, Imtiaz Ali’s Jab We Met remains an all-time favourite among its fans. Kareena Kapoor’s portrayal of the central character Geet continues to be appreciated, and the performance is often ranked among the best of her career. During a conversation with Hindustan Times, when asked why every film she does is compared to her iconic performance, Kareena said: “ It will always be compared to Geet, she is iconic I understand. But I feel people should talk about Chameli, Omkara and Heroine – they’re pretty underrated in terms of my performances.” Likening Jab We Met to “Ghar ki khichdi“, she said: “You see it again and again, it doesn’t seem like an old film. That’s rare.”

 

The final trailer for the Hindi-Telugu bilingual epic Adipurush, starring Prabhas, Kriti Sanon, Saif Ali Khan, Sunny Singh, and Devdatta Nage, was released at a grand pre-release event in Tirupati on Tuesday, 6th June. More than one lakh fans were said to have attended the event. As far as the new trailer of the Om Raut directorial goes, it is not as sub-standard as the first teaser of the film, which prompted a months-long delay in its release. The opening sequence of the trailer–the kidnapping of Janaki by Lankesh–features some detailed CGI work. However, such quality is inconsistent, though it is not a matter of concern for Prabhas’ fans as the trailer crossed over 350k views in minutes.

 

Meanwhile, megastar Amitabh Bachchan makes it a point to greet his fans every Sunday outside his Mumbai residence, and in a recent blog post, Bachchan shared several photos of one such meet-and-greet. The actor wrote – “I feel they wait for hours in this sweltering heat, so we provide them drinking water with lime to quench their thirst .. 4 containers, 2 on either side of the gate.” The actor said that he greets his fans barefoot, and when people “sarcastically” comment, “Who goes out wearing socks and bare feet?” He explained his reason for doing so. He shared – “You go to the temple bare feet… my well-wishers are my temple.”

 

Ever since Bengali superstar Prosenjit Chatterjee revealed that he was the first choice for director Sooraj Barjatya’s blockbuster romantic drama Maine Pyar Kiya, fans have been curious to know more about the actor’s decision to turn the opportunity down. Although Prosenjit had previously shown disinterest in discussing the matter, he recently addressed the topic. During a chat with Mashable India, the actor shared – ” It’s all fate. The most important point is that one of India’s top-most stars and greatest actors, Salman Khan, whom I respect, was born through Maine Pyar Kiya. I have lost other films too which went on to become big successes. Why regret such things? We have to go forward.”

 

Lastly, in an old interview that has now surfaced on the internet, Pooja Bedi talks about how her life changed after she decided to part ways with her husband, Farhan Furniturewala. In an interview with Doordarshan Sahyadri, Bedi was asked how she built her life post-separation, especially because she walked out of the marriage without alimony from her ex-husband. Bedi, a mother of two, including actor Alaya F, said – “Back in the day, the court systems were different and the women’s rights movement wasn’t so active the way it is today. I thought if I go to court and fight it out, there will be bitterness, my kids will suffer as well.”
